summaryrefslogtreecommitdiff
path: root/clrdefinitions.cmake
diff options
context:
space:
mode:
authorGaurav Khanna <gkhanna@microsoft.com>2016-04-29 08:00:17 -0700
committerGaurav Khanna <gkhanna@microsoft.com>2016-05-02 08:55:22 -0700
commit9dc862d0b7fbb31c150501f6d11dfe81bbfa673c (patch)
treed5974cec9f217d34a369161045eac351fe4c4052 /clrdefinitions.cmake
parente18a26aabee632497cbf4be6258c3c930d004824 (diff)
downloadcoreclr-9dc862d0b7fbb31c150501f6d11dfe81bbfa673c.tar.gz
coreclr-9dc862d0b7fbb31c150501f6d11dfe81bbfa673c.tar.bz2
coreclr-9dc862d0b7fbb31c150501f6d11dfe81bbfa673c.zip
Enable crossgen to load JIT from a custom location
Continue to link the JIT in for Windows Arm64 builds until 4717 is fixed.
Diffstat (limited to 'clrdefinitions.cmake')
-rw-r--r--clrdefinitions.cmake4
1 files changed, 4 insertions, 0 deletions
diff --git a/clrdefinitions.cmake b/clrdefinitions.cmake
index c5352c0482..58b9ad24c1 100644
--- a/clrdefinitions.cmake
+++ b/clrdefinitions.cmake
@@ -134,7 +134,11 @@ add_definitions(-DFEATURE_MERGE_CULTURE_SUPPORT_AND_ENGINE)
# TODO_DJIT: Remove this "set" to commence loading JIT dynamically.
if(NOT WIN32)
set(FEATURE_MERGE_JIT_AND_ENGINE 1)
+elseif (CLR_CMAKE_TARGET_ARCH_ARM64)
+ # TODO_DJIT: Remove this as part of enabling cross-compiling standalone JIT binary.
+ set(FEATURE_MERGE_JIT_AND_ENGINE 1)
endif(NOT WIN32)
+
if(FEATURE_MERGE_JIT_AND_ENGINE)
# Disable the following for UNIX altjit on Windows
add_definitions(-DFEATURE_MERGE_JIT_AND_ENGINE)